The Disabilities Trust believes that in today’s Britain people with disabilities (including those with profound and complex needs) should be supported to make a full and meaningful contribution to our society.
We believe that all stakeholders should work to ensure that barriers preventing them from doing so are eliminated.
The Disabilities Trust is currently working to highlight a number of issues that affect the lives of people with disabilities.
